CalOPPA - California Online Privacy Protection Act

CalOPPA is a California state law that functions as one of the primary data privacy laws in the United States. The law came into effect in July 2004, and is applicable to the operators of commercial websites or online services that collect personally identifiable information about consumers residing in California. Following a 2012 agreement between the California Attorney General and mobile app providers, CalOPPA also applies to mobile apps. NOTE: There is wide overlap between CalOPPA and the CCPA, and the majority of requirements of CCPA are applicable to those of CalOPPA.

What kind of information does CalOPPA apply to?

Under CalOPPA, "Personally Identifiable Information" includes but is not limited to:

  • First and last names;
  • Home or physical street addresses;
  • E-mail address;
  • Telephone number;
  • Any other information that permits a specific individual to be contacted physically or online.

The California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) and The California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A)

The CCPA is a California state law which passed in 2018 and came into effect in 2020. Similarly to CalOPPA, the CCPA applies to businesses that impact individuals in California. In January 2023, the CPRA came into force, introducing a number of amendments to the CCPA. The updated regulations stipulate restrictions on the utilization of personal data, emphasizing that the collection, retention, and usage should be confined to what is essential for providing goods or services.

What businesses does the CPPA apply to?

Under the CPPA (CPRA), a "business" is any legal entity which:

  • Pursues a profit;
  • Operates in California;
  • Determines the purposes and means of the processing of consumers' personal information;
  • Complies with one or more of the following:
    • Has an annual gross revenue of more than $25 million;
    • Annually buys, sells, receives or shares personal information from at least 100,000 devices, consumers or households;
    • Makes at least 50 percent of its annual revenue by selling or sharing consumers' personal information.
